Nonsense, unless you are feeding your cat the very cheapest crap you can find. Cat food is higher in protein than dog food, cats are obligate carnivores, not omnivores like dogs, and good quality cat food contains meat and usually whey protein. The protein content is much too high for a rabbit.0 -
